The ingredients needed to make Black Bean Quesidilla:
- Prepare 1 can Black Bean
- Take 1 1/2 cup Monterey Jack Shredded Cheese
- Take 1 1/2 cup Salsa
- Make ready 3 Tortillas
- Take 1 tsp olive oil, extra virgin per tortilla
- Get 1 Avocado

Instructions to make Black Bean Quesidilla:
- Combine beans, cheese and 1/4 cup salsa in a medium bowl. Place tortillas on a work surface.
- Place tortillas on a work surface. Spread 1/2 cup filling on half of each tortilla. Fold tortillas in half, pressing gently to flatten.
- Heat 1 teaspoon o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at.
- Add quesadilla and cook, turning once, until golden on both sides, 2 to 4 minutes total.
- Transfer to a cutting board and tent with foil to keep warm.
- Repeat with the remaining 1 teaspoon oil and quesadillas.
- Cut the Avocado and use it for flavor if desired.
